NAME
       CURLINFO_STARTTRANSFER_TIME  -  get  the	 time  until the first byte is
       received

SYNOPSIS
       #include <curl/curl.h>

       CURLcode curl_easy_getinfo(CURL	*handle,  CURLINFO_STARTTRANSFER_TIME,
       double *timep);

DESCRIPTION
       Pass  a	pointer	 to  a double to receive the time, in seconds, it took
       from the start until the	 first	byte  is  received  by	libcurl.  This
       includes	 CURLINFO_PRETRANSFER_TIME(3)  and  also  the  time the server
       needs to calculate the result.

       See also the TIMES overview in the curl_easy_getinfo(3) man page.

PROTOCOLS
       All

EXAMPLE
       TODO

AVAILABILITY
       Added in 7.9.2

RETURN VALUE
       Returns CURLE_OK if the option is supported,  and  CURLE_UNKNOWN_OPTION
       if not.

SEE ALSO
       curl_easy_getinfo(3), curl_easy_setopt(3),
